Handover — Cold Storage Archival (Quellhaven team)

Mira, before my rotation ends: the Brinemist cold storage buckets for Q3 are staged for archival, but the lifecycle job paused mid-run after the Glacierpoint policy update. Please verify checksums on the staging manifest before resuming, and do not delete the interim copies until the audit log confirms transfer. The archival vault will prompt for credentials on resume; enter the recovery passphrase printed below.

vault phrase of bagaf-kajeg = jorath-feniel-briir-siliel-ralix

Subject: Cold-start cut-over done — please eyeball

Hey, quick wrap-up before you review the PR. We finished cutting the Fernwick serverless handlers over to the pre-warmed pool last night. Cold starts dropped from multi-second to basically nothing on the checkout path, and the warm-pool sizing logic is now config-driven instead of hardcoded, which is most of the diff. One gotcha: the idle reaper is aggressive, so don't be surprised by churn in the metrics. The settings we went live with are pasted below.

deployment values, hahip-kajep:
HOLAX_PIN=4003
HOLAX_METRICS_HOST=metrics.holax.zemvarworks.internal
HOLAX_LOG_LEVEL=warn
HOLAX_TENANT=fraael

Team, the Marlow Public Library catalogue import finished its third dry run on Bookspindle last night. We ingested roughly 210k records; 312 were quarantined for malformed publication dates, which Priya is triaging with a normalization pass. Duplicate detection now keys on title plus edition rather than ISBN alone, which cut false merges considerably. We intend to run the production import Thursday evening, pending sign-off at the sync. The dry-run's build token is recorded below for reference.

pipeline stamp: htk21_86b657ac0aa916a9af17f

**Alert: ShrinkRay batch failure rate elevated**

The ShrinkRay CLI is reporting >5% failed resize jobs over the last 15 minutes. Common causes: corrupt source uploads, worker disk pressure, or a bad preset pushed by a customer. Check the job error sample before escalating to the imaging team. Triage steps and known-issue workarounds are kept on the internal page below.

wiki page, bagaf-fawip: https://harbor.tolvaqsys.local/pages/repo/pages/secrets/eac969ffc71f356b